Technical Description
An 18th century air twist wine glass dating to c1750. It has a bell bowl above a multi spiral air twist stwm with two swelling knops. Conical foot.
Date & Origin
Europe, c1750. Period of George II.
Condition
Excellent, age-related wear as shown, no chips cracks or restoration.
Dimensions
Height: 17.8cm, Rim diameter: 7.5cm, Folded Foot diameter: 7.8cm.
